Expert AI · Mechanic's Insight
The vehicle’s most recent MOT on 2026-02-10 at 151,289 miles recorded a pass with no defects, indicating a stable condition at the time of testing. However, the preceding two MOTs in 2025-02-28 and 2025-01-27 both failed at nearly identical mileages (141,407 and 141,375) without recorded defects, suggesting potential unresolved issues or procedural inconsistencies. The lack of defect details in these failures complicates a definitive assessment, but the rapid return to a passable state implies corrective actions were taken. Overall, the maintenance trend shows intermittent issues that may have been addressed, though the absence of detailed records limits certainty. The vehicle’s mileage of 151,289 miles at 11 years old equates to approximately 13,754 annual miles, exceeding typical usage for its age. A significant jump from 128,541 miles in 2024 to 141,407 in 2025 reflects a 12,866-mile increase within 12 months, raising concerns about wear on consumables and mechanical systems. The 2025-02-27 failure at 141,398 miles occurred just 13 miles after the previous test, suggesting either a short interval between assessments or potential oversight in addressing emerging faults. The sparse defect data in these tests limits analysis, but the high mileage and rapid accumulation imply increased risk of suspension, brake, and drivetrain wear. A buyer should prioritise inspecting the suspension system for worn bushes or coil springs, given the high mileage, and check for binding calipers or uneven brake disc wear, which could result from excessive use. Corrosion in underbody components, particularly around the exhaust system, warrants scrutiny due to the vehicle’s age and exposure to road conditions. The absence of recorded exhaust emissions data in recent tests also highlights the need for a thorough inspection of the catalytic converter and emission control systems. While the latest MOT confirms roadworthiness, the history underscores the importance of verifying mechanical integrity beyond documented records.
